Before You Cook
Cooking Guidelines
To ensure food safety, the FDA recommends the following as minimum internal cooking temperatures:
- Steak and Pork 145° F (rest cooked meat, 3 minutes) |
- Seafood 145° F |
- Chicken 165° F |
- Ground Beef 160° F |
- Ground Turkey 165° F |
- Ground Pork 160° F

Prepare the Ingredients
Trim zucchini ends, halve lengthwise, and cut into 1/2" slices.
Zest and halve lemon. Cut one half into wedges and juice remaining half.Trim cucumber. Using a box grater, grate cucumber into a mixing bowl.Stem and mince dill.Remove Italian sausage from casing, if necessary. -
Form the Meatballs
In another mixing bowl, combine panko and 2 Tbsp. water. Rest, 1 minute.
Add Italian sausage, half the dill (reserve remaining for sauce), and a pinch of salt. Mix thoroughly until combined.Form mixture into 16 evenly-sized meatballs. -
Cook the Meatballs
Place a large non-stick pan over medium heat and add 1 tsp. olive oil.
Add meatballs to hot pan. Cover and roll occasionally until browned all over and meatballs reach a minimum internal temperature of 160 degrees, 8-10 minutes.Transfer meatballs to a plate or bowl. Drain pan, reserving 1 Tbsp. oil. Keep pan over medium heat. -
Add the Couscous
Add zucchini to hot pan. Stir occasionally until beginning to soften, 3-4 minutes.
Add couscous, 1 tsp. lemon zest, 1 Tbsp. lemon juice, 1/4 tsp. salt, a pinch of pepper, and pesto. Stir until combined.Add meatballs. Cover and stir occasionally until zucchini is tender, 3-4 minutes.Remove from burner. -
Make Sauce and Finish Dish
Add sour cream, remaining dill, and a pinch of salt and pepper to bowl with grated cucumber. Stir to combine.
Plate dish as pictured on front of card, topping meatballs with sauce and garnishing couscous with cheese. Bon appétit!
